Each frame of time-series pictures shot by a camera is converted to a spatial differential frame picture by the following equations: H(i, j) = UNION ¾ G(i+di, j+dj) - G(i, j) ¾ / (Gi, j, max / Gmax), I = Gmax / ä1 + exp(-0.02(H - 80))ü, where UNION denotes a sum over di = -1 to 1 and dj = -1 to 1, Gi,j,max denotes the maximum pixel value of 3x3 pixels having its center at the i-th row and j-th column, and Gmax denotes the assumable maximum value 255 of the pixel value G(i, j). Moving objects at a time t are discriminated based on a correlation between spatial differential frame pictures at times (t-1) and t and a discrimination result of moving objects included in the spatial differential frame picture at the time (t-1) .
